I am hoping for a +2 point increase to 1016 if ZTO isn't included, and a +3 to 1017 if it is...the rounds i'll be adding are over my average, but I'll be dropping a bunch of good rounds too from last year (beaver state fling, etc).
(The way rounds drop off your rating is if you have a new round that is more than a year newer. So, if ZTO is included, all rounds occurring prior to June 12, 2010 should drop off any ZTO participant's rating.)
